Modules Covered

Learners choose any six of the following modules, contributing to a total of hours of guided learning and self-directed study:

  1. Corporate Finance (CBIT-AAFM-701):
    Gain a comprehensive understanding of corporate finance tools and techniques including capital budgeting, capital structure, dividend policy, working capital management, and mergers and acquisitions.
  2. Strategic Management Accounting (CBIT-AAFM-702):
    Explore the strategic use of management accounting information to support planning, control, and performance enhancement. Learn to integrate financial and non-financial data for strategic decision-making.
  3. Financial Reporting (CBIT-AAFM-703):
    Develop in-depth expertise in preparing, presenting, and interpreting financial statements in line with International Financial Reporting Standards (IFRS), and critically analyse their implications for stakeholders.
  4. Investment Management (CBIT-AAFM-704):
    Study portfolio construction, asset class analysis, and investment evaluation. Understand risk-return dynamics and ethical considerations in investment decision-making.
  5. Finance for Decision Making (CBIT-AAFM-705):
    Build advanced financial analysis and control skills to support strategic planning. Learn to interpret financial data, evaluate investments, and assess financial risks for informed decision-making.
  6. Financial Risk Management (CBIT-AAFM-706):
    Master the identification, analysis, and mitigation of financial risks within modern markets. Apply tools for measuring and managing exposure to market, credit, and liquidity risks.
  7. Ethics in Finance (CBIT-AAFM-707):
    Examine ethical dilemmas and governance standards in finance. Apply ethical frameworks and regulatory practices to ensure accountability in financial decision-making.
  8. Research Methods for Accounting (CBIT-AAFM-708):
    Develop practical research skills in accounting through the application of empirical methodologies. Design and conduct investigations into complex financial and accounting issues.
